Course Content

• Basic Plumbing Repairs & Maintenance
• Electrical Safety & Minor Repairs (including GFCI outlets)
• Home Appliance Troubleshooting & Repair (refrigerator, washing machine, dryer)
• Drywall Repair & Painting Techniques
• Basic Carpentry & Woodworking for Home Repairs
• Pest Control & Prevention for Extended Stays
• Understanding Home Systems: HVAC and Water Heater Basics
• Home Security & Safety Measures (fire safety, carbon monoxide detection)
• Preventative Home Maintenance for Extended Stays
